FRONT PANEL CONTROLS

STANDBY
The Classé C-303 also has a STANDBY BUTTON located on the left side of the front panel which
permits you to partially shut down the unit while keeping warmed up parts of the circuitry .
INPUT SELECTOR:
The input selector (see fig.4, page 16) has two buttons for selecting the inputs; (<) and (>).
Pressing the < button.
selects the input to the left of the currently selected input, and pressing the > button selects the input
to the right of the currently selected input. If the > button is pressed when BAL1 is the current input
then the REG1 input will be selected, and if the < button when REG1 is the current input then the
BAL1 input will be selected. The < and > buttons will select from five input connections on the
preamplifier, but not the TAPE, (see TAPE below).
TAPE
In the SOURCE position (TAPE LED OFF), the preamp will process the signal as chosen by
the INPUT SELECTOR. In the TAPE position (TAPE LED ON (RED)), the preamp will process the
TAPE INPUT signal, overriding the INPUT SELECTOR.
VOLUME CONTROL
The VOLUME CONTROL varies the output level of both channels simultaneously. It can be
operated by remote using the hand held control unit (see fig.4, Page 16) or manually
